Graduate Assistant (PT) – OSETC

Office of Science Engineering and Technical Careers (OSETC) is seeking a part‑time Graduate Assistant to assist in their office. This position is 15 hours a week. Work schedule to be determined, with flexibility approved by manager. Anticipated end date May 9, 2025.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Perform administrative tasks including preparation of PowerPoint presentations, data entry and analysis, collaborating with web development team for program updates on the website, collating marketing materials and presentations for prospective students, corporate partners and graduate schools.
  • Provide assistance with event planning including supervision of undergraduate student workers.
  • Facilitate projects in an office with other students; serve on short‑term college project teams.
  • Support departmental processes related to student recruitment including contacting prospective students, creating marketing materials, peer advising/mentoring, conducting campus tours and orientation activities, and delivering presentations.
  • Analyze and trend historical data for the OSETC and DDEP programs focusing on matriculation and retention rates and document findings.
  • Perform research in assessment and in locating helpful mentoring and STEM retention sites.
  • Provide support and research for projects, grants, and ongoing departmental activities. Plan, coordinate, and evaluate the Women in Engineering mentoring program, including matching mentors and mentees, scheduling events, and compiling quarterly reports.
  • Other duties as assigned.
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ree, preferably in STEM, is required.
  • Must be currently enrolled in a graduate program.
  • Must be proficient in the MS Office Suite, especially MS Access.
  • Excellent computer skills and ability to analyze and interpret data.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
